A pilot creates one feed in the portal, gets a link and a five word password, and sends both to the incident commander by text. That is the whole handoff. The IC needs no account with us and none with the aircraft manufacturer.
The link is persistent. A division that used it on one night already has it for the next, so there is nothing new to distribute at 2300 when the aircraft goes up.
We flew it on a live incident the night it shipped. Bind the aircraft, a dot appears on the map, the stream starts on its own.
Steadiness is what we are working on next. A feed that stalls is worse than a feed running a few seconds behind, so we are tuning for smooth before we tune for fast.
